Dirty D Arrested in Fla., Posts $200,000 Bond

TAMPA, Fla. — Dirty D was released by authorities this afternoon after he posted a $200,000 bond, XBIZ has learned.

He was arrested at Tampa International Airport after arriving on an international flight, according to Hillsborough County Sheriff's spokesman J.D. Calloway.

St. Petersburg, Fla., attorney A.J. Comparetto told XBIZ that Dirty D will be represented by a team of four attorneys in the case. The names of the attorneys, besides Comparetto, weren't revealed at post time.

"This case is super-huge for the adult entertainment industry; it's a mini-Tracy Lords case," said Comparetto, who noted that Florida authorities seized terabytes of video from Dirty D's office and could possibly charge him with additional counts. "They've got years of his content."

Florida authorities are charging Dirty D with two counts of the promotion of a sexual performance of a child and two counts of the use of a child in a sexual performance. Each of the counts require a $50,000 bond for release.

Prosecutors, however, declined to charge Dirty D with one count of illegal computer pornography, which refers to the streaming of underage content, that was originally listed on his arrest warrant.

Dirty D several weeks ago told XBIZ in an interview that the claims made by a woman who says she was underage at the time of a Tampa Bay porn shoot in August 2007 are false.

He made that statement after XBIZ contacted him in Barcelona, where he just finished attending the Barcelona Summit.

Dirty D said that the woman, who goes by the porn pseudonym Kelsey Cummings, among others, apparently used a fake ID for productions that involved a sea of men in a gloryhole shoot and a solo scene at a home.

Police already have charged two of Dirty D's employees — Shawn Chastain and Ryan Jay Holtz — with two counts each of promoting a sexual performance by a child. Both have been released on $20,000 bail.

The woman, according to police reports, said Chastain, Holtz and Dirty D all were aware that she was under 18.

Dirty D denied the allegations by the woman, saying that her statements are "completely false and inflammatory."

Dirty D operates GloryHoleGirlz.com, GhettoConfessions.com, RealOrgasmVideos.com, GangBangHood.com and AlmostFemale.com, and produces and distributes related DVDs. He also owns affiliate program HowIGotRich.com.

Police were tipped to the case when they received a mailed letter that included photos of the woman in the act of fellatio on the site GloryHolesGirlz.com.

Police served warrants and seized much of his Tampa Bay-based business operations and took cash, videos and 10 terabytes of data, Dirty D said.
